L1 Visa Delhi Can Be Fun For Anyone Table of ContentsThings about L1 Visa DelhiFascination About L1 Visa DelhiL1 Visa Delhi - An OverviewL1 Visa Delhi - The FactsHow L1 Visa Delhi can Save You Time, Stress, and Money.All about L1 Visa DelhiAll About L1 Visa Delhibusiness. With an L1 https://daltonaippd.blogolize.com/not-known-facts-about-l1-visa-delhi-76052560